Lyme Academy College of Fine Arts vs. Western New England University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Lyme Academy College of Fine Arts or Western New England University?

  • Western New England University is 44.8% more expensive to attend than Lyme Academy College of Fine Arts for in-state tuition ($41,750.00 vs. $28,824.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 44.8% higher at Western New England University than Lyme Academy College of Fine Arts ($41,750.00 vs. $28,824.00)
  • The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at Lyme Academy College of Fine Arts than Western New England University ($24,832 vs. $30,214)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Lyme Academy College of Fine Arts are 40.2% lower than costs at Western New England University ($10,463 vs. $14,670)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at Lyme Academy College of Fine Arts than Western New England University (100% vs. 97%)
  • The average total grant financial aid received by Western New England University students is 101.3% larger than aid received Lyme Academy College of Fine Arts ($24,781 vs. $12,308)
